مَنْ كَتَمَ صَوْمَهُ قَالَ اللَّهُ عَزَّ وَ جَلَّ لِمَلَائِكَتِهِ عَبْدِي اسْتَجَارَ مِنْ عَذَابِي فَأَجِيرُوهُ وَ وَكَّلَ اللَّهُ تَعَالَى مَلَائِكَتَهُ بِالدُّعَاءِ لِلصَّائِمِينَ وَ لَمْ يَأْمُرْهُمْ بِالدُّعَاءِ لِأَحَدٍ إِلَّا اسْتَجَابَ لَهُمْ فِيهِ.

Ali ibn Ibrahim has narrated from his father, from al-Nawfaliy from al-Sakuniy who has said the following: “Abu ‘Abd Allah (a.s.), has said that if a person fasts secretly, Allah, the Most Majestic, the Most Glorious, says to His angels, ‘My servant has sought protection against my punishment, you must give him protection.’ Allah, the most Blessed, the most High, then assigns His angels to pray for the fasting people and in whoever’ s favor He commands them to pray, He hears and accepts their prayers.’”
